What advantages do moving frame hives offer? Revolutionize Bee Germplasm Surveys with Non-Destructive Sampling


Moving frame hives fundamentally alter honeybee germplasm surveys by replacing destructive harvesting with precise, non-invasive sampling. Unlike traditional methods that often necessitate the destruction of the hive or the use of fire, moving frame technology allows technicians to extract specific worker bee samples without harming the colony structure. This ensures the preservation of the genetic resource itself, allowing the colony to thrive long after the sample is taken.

The shift to moving frame hives transforms germplasm surveys from single-point data collection into continuous, longitudinal studies. By preserving the colony during sampling, researchers can maintain standardized observation protocols across different altitudes and localities over time.

The Mechanics of Non-Destructive Research

Preserving Colony Integrity

In traditional honey collection, accessing the comb often means destroying the nest. This renders the colony useless for future study.

Moving frame hives allow for the removal of individual frames. Researchers can access the brood and bees necessary for germplasm analysis without compromising the hive's structural integrity.

Eliminating External Interference

Traditional methods frequently utilize fire or heavy smoke to subdue bees during harvest. This can damage biological samples and introduce stress variables that skew data.

Moving frames facilitate extraction without these aggressive measures. This results in "cleaner" biological samples and ensures the behavioral data collected represents the colony's natural state.

Standardization and Long-Term Tracking

Enabling Longitudinal Studies

Germplasm surveys are most valuable when they track changes over time.

Because the colony survives the sampling process, moving frame hives allow for long-term observation. Researchers can return to the same specific colony to monitor development, disease resistance, and genetic traits across seasons.

Consistent Environmental Variables

To accurately compare germplasm resources, the living environment must be consistent.

Improved box hives provide a standardized physical structure. This creates a stable internal environment, ensuring that differences observed between colonies are due to genetics (germplasm) rather than variations in hive construction quality.

Geographic Versatility

Germplasm surveys often span diverse topographies.

The standardized nature of this equipment facilitates tracking colonies across different altitudes and localities. This makes moving frame hives essential infrastructure for mapping biodiversity on a macro scale.

Understanding the Operational Requirements

Technical Proficiency

While superior for research, moving frame hives require a higher level of technical skill to manage than traditional log or basket hives.

Technicians must be trained to manipulate frames gently to maintain the non-destructive advantage. Improper handling can still result in queen loss or colony aggression.

Management Interfaces

The transition requires adopting new management interfaces.

While this offers benefits like precise placement for pollination and potentially two harvests per year, it demands a more rigorous maintenance schedule compared to the "set and forget" nature of some traditional methods.
